Team India broke its 10-year drought of reaching the T20 World Cup final by defeating England by 68 runs in the 2024 semi-final. India's spectacular victory sent a wave of joy among Indian cricket fans worldwide. Indians celebrated this achievement in every street and locality. However, former England captain Michael Vaughan claimed that the pre-decided ground in Guyana was a major factor for India's victory over England. On this, former cricketer and one of the all-time legends Harbhajan Singh lashed out at Vaughan over X (formerly twitter).

Michael Vaughan claims - Venue changed favoured India to win

Following England's defeat at the hands of India, former captain Michael Vaughan tweeted – If England had beaten SA they would have got the Trinidad semi and I believe they would have won that game . So no complaints they haven’t been good enough. But Guyana has been a lovely venue pick for India.” Harbhajan lashed out in response.

Harbhajan Singh's response:

Former cricketer Harbhajan Singh lashed out in response, tweeting, “What makes u think Guyana was a good venue for India? Both Teams played on the same venue. England won the toss that was an advantage. Stop being silly. England was outplayed by India in all departments. Accept the fact and Move on and keep your rubbish with yourself. Talk logic not Nonsense”

Vaughan raises questions on venue

Vaughan has been constantly talking about a change of venue for the semi-finals in the T20 World Cup 2024. The former England captain blamed the ICC for favouring India with a pre-decided venue for the T20 World Cup semi-finals. He also shared a few posts ahead of the start of the semi-final between India and England, revealing that Rohit Sharma's side were originally scheduled to play their semi-final in Trinidad but the venue was later changed to Guyana.  It was being claimed that the decision was taken for commercial interests and higher viewership in India, and that the team would play in Guyana irrespective of their position in the Super Eight. However, in his post, Vaughan also admitted that India were a better team than England on the day.

He earlier shared a tweet congratulating India on their performance in the world cup, saying, “India throughly deserve to be in the final .. The best team in tournament so far .. Was always going to hard for England on this pitch .. India just so much better on lower slower spinning pitches.”

T20 World Cup final:

Talking about the T20 World Cup final, South Africa were the first team to reach the showcase event when they beat Afghanistan by nine wickets, reaching 60/1 in response to their opponents' 56 all out.They will face India, who beat defending champions England by 68 runs to make it to the final. The two will facing off at 10.30am local time (3.30pm BST, 4.30pm SAST, 8pm IST) at the Kensington Oval on Saturday, 29 June.
